Definitions

jiàn (noun) mountain stream; ravine

About

The character "涧" derives from its traditional form "澗", structured with the water radical "氵" and the component "間", which provided phonetic cues and conveyed the concept of an interval, leading to the meaning of a stream between mountains. Over centuries, the character's application has centered on mountain gorges or waterflows in valleys. The simplified form "涧" replaces "間" with "间", a graphical simplification that retains the water radical and the phonetic role, while the character's core meaning remains associated with water in constrained topographic features.
